Meta's $135 Billion AI Bet: Boosting Nvidia & Changing Crypto Dynamics
Meta Platforms plans to increase its capital spending on AI infrastructure to up to $135 billion by 2026. This massive outlay is set to benefit Nvidia while potentially reshaping the crypto landscape.
Meta Platforms is gearing up for a massive leap in artificial intelligence infrastructure spending. With plans to invest between $115 billion and $135 billion by 2026, the tech giant isn't just playing catch-up. it's setting the pace. This isn't just about internal enhancement, it's a strategic move that could shake up cloud computing and beyond. But what does this mean for the crypto world?
Meta's AI Ambitions: Numbers Don't Lie
Last year, Meta spent $72.2 billion on capital expenses. Fast forward to 2026, and the planned expenditure almost doubles, targeting AI infrastructure. This surge underscores a strategic pivot to integrate AI across core business operations and its ambitious Superintelligence Labs division. With AI at the heart of tech innovation, the investment is timely. It's not just a financial gamble. It's a calculated maneuver to remain a tech leader.
But where's all this money going? A significant chunk will undoubtedly be funneled into AI hardware, giving industry heavyweight Nvidia a considerable boost. Nvidia's chips are critical for AI tasks, and their demand is skyrocketing. Could this be the start of a new era where AI hardware becomes as turning point as oil once was to industrial powerhouses?
